NOTES: This is a started rope horse that has been pen roped and breakaway roped on. Also, she is loping around the barrels, has been used to check cattle and is just a nice all around using horse.
SIRE: SPORTY FLO (2001). Split top 10 Oklahoma Early Bird Open Cutting Futurity. Full brother to HICKORYS GOLDEN FLO ($186,179: 3rd NCHA Open Super Stakes); half-brother to RIO TAZZY ($102,159: 3rd NCHA Limited Non-Pro Futurity). Sire of SQUEAK N FLO (NCHA money-earner), SPORTY KING (NCHA money-earner). Son of MR PEPONITA FLO, $148,875: NCHA Open Futurity Reserve Champion; finalist NCHA Open Super Stakes; Gold Coast Open Classic/Challenge Reserve Champion; finalist Montgomery 4-Year-Old Open Futurity; 4th Biggest Little Cutting 4-Year-Old Open. Sire of 140 money-earners, $2,928,382, 37 AQHA point-earners, including SHAKIN FLO ($429,106: NCHA Horse of the Year, NCHA Hall of Fame), HICKORYS GOLDEN FLO ($186,179: 3rd NCHA Open Super Stakes), MO FLO ($130,784: finalist NCHA Open Futurity; NCHA Bronze Award), GET HER FLOWING ($112,546: PCCHA Open Classic/Challenge Champion), SUNSPOT FLO ($105,905: finalist Breeders Inv. Open Derby), FELINA FLO ($103,551: top 10 NCHA Open Futurity), FLOS JEWEL ($54,928: NCHA Non-Pro Co-Reserve World Champion; NCHA Bronze Award), COMMANDER FLO ($90,737: Suncoast Fall Non-Pro Futurity Champion), FLO MOTION (D) ($78,382: 4th Suncoast Fall Open Futurity; NCHA Bronze Award), LITTLE MO FLO ($64,739: 3rd Arizona CHA Mowery Futurity Open), COSMO FLO ($61,675: PCCHA Fall 4-Year-Old Cutting Stakes Open Co-Reserve Champion), INCREDI BABE ($60,085: top 10 PCCHA Open Derby; NCHA Bronze Award), CHECK THE FLO ($58,987: top 10 Memphis Cutting 4-Year-Old Open Futurity).
DAM: TAZS GIZMO (2001). Half-sister to TAZ N WOOD ($3,541 and an AQHA point-earner: Fort Worth Stock Show AQHA Open Versatility Ranch Horse Champion). A daughter of DOC DRY; sire of DD CLEOPATRA ($6,853: South Dakota CHA 3-Year-Old Open Reserve Champion), DD CUTT N DRY (PHBA Honor Roll Junior Pole Bending Champion), TIZA DOC DRY (AQHA point-earner; NRCHA $1,041), DD LITTLE SHEBA (5th FQHR Roundup & Review Cutting Open), PLAYING WITH TIME (NRHA money-earner), DD TURNAROUND SUE (NCHA money-earner), RY CEE BURNIE SMOKUM (5th ARHA World All-Age Ranch Sorting Youth). Son of DRY DOC, $85,148 and 96 AQHA points: AQHA Reserve World Champion Senior Cutting Horse; NCHA Open Futurity Champion; Superior Cutting. Sire of 468 money-earners, $4,981,668, earners of 3,380 AQHA points, including DRY CLEAN ($284,250 and 34.5 AQHA points: NCHA Open Super Stakes Champion; NCHA Bronze Award), DE DOC ($238,720 and 39.5 AQHA points: NCHA Non-Pro Co-World Champion; NCHA Platinum Award), DRY OIL ($237,880: NCHA $1,500 Novice World Champion), DRY DOT ($104,264: NCHA Non-Pro Super Stakes Champion), BO DOC (U) ($168,000: NCHA World Champion Gelding; NCHA Silver Award), DRY DOC'S DOTTIE ($162,529: NCHA World Champion Mare; NCHA Platinum Award), DRYIN TIME ($32,232 and 38.5 AQHA points: AQHA World Champion Senior Cutting Horse; NCHA Bronze Award), EXTRA DRY CHEX (19.5 AQHA points: AQHA Reserve World Champion Senior Reining Horse).
